About The Position

Performs landscape gardener work by preparing and maintaining landscaped areas as part of the services provided by the Facilities Management department to maintain university buildings and grounds. Incumbent is assigned to a central landscape maintenance group and performs semi-skilled landscape labor work in accordance with industry/trade practices. Workers perform monthly assignments according to seasonal schedules, in response to requests for service (e.g. preventive maintenance of storm drain throughout the campus) and in response to emergencies. Incumbent use all standard tools, equipment, materials and supplies of the trade and observes all safety rules, regulations and precautions in performing their duties. This worker supports a direct service of the department in ensuring an attractive, comfortable, safe and clean environment in which the University community can live, learn and work.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alency
  • One to three years of grounds landscape maintenance experience
  • Valid driver’s license
  • Ability to operate pickup trucks, tractors, skid steer loaders, all-terrain vehicles and other specialized grounds equipment

Responsibilities

  • Grass mowing, trimming and edging
  • Removal of weeds and daily policing of the grounds
  • Irrigating lawns and planted areas
  • Mulching
  • Reactivating flower beds and tree saucers
  • Laying sod
  • Assisting in the application of pesticides
  • Performing monthly assignments according to seasonal schedules
  • Responding to requests for service (e.g. preventive maintenance of storm drain throughout the campus)
  • Responding to emergencies
